// ﷽
#include<bits/stdc++.h>
using namespace std;
#define ll long long
#define cinv(c) for(auto &i:c){cin>>i;}
#define coutv(x) for(auto &i:x){cout<<i<<endl;}
void solve(){
ll n;
vector<ll> a[9];
cin>>n;
for(auto i=0;i<n;i++){
ll x,c,d;
cin>>x>>c>>d;
if(c<=4 and d>4){
a[c].push_back(x);
}
else if(c>4 and d<=4){
a[c].push_back(x);
}
}
ll ans,ls;
ans=0;
for(auto y=1;y<5;y++){
ls=-101;
for(auto i:a[y]){
ans+=100;
if(i-ls<=10){
ans+=50;
}
ls=i;
}
} cout<<ans<<' ';
ans=0;
for(auto y=5;y<9;y++){
ls=-101;
for(auto i:a[y]){
ans+=100;
if(i-ls<=10){
ans+=50;
}
ls=i;
}
} cout<<ans<<' ';
}
int main(){
ll n=1;
while(n--){
solve();
}
}
| # | Verdict | Execution time | Memory | Grader output |
|---|
| Fetching results... |
| # | Verdict | Execution time | Memory | Grader output |
|---|
| Fetching results... |
| # | Verdict | Execution time | Memory | Grader output |
|---|
| Fetching results... |